One album that everyone should take a listen to this coming February is the full-length debut album by the Pains of Being Pure at Heart. They are currently on tour in the UK supporting The Wedding Present. A dose of dreamy noise pop never hurt anyone!
2/7 - New York City - Mercury Lounge *#
2/8 - Philadelphia, PA - Kung Fu Necktie *
2/9 - Washington, DC - Black Cat Backstage *
2/11 - Chicago, IL - Schubas *
2/12 - Toronto, ON - Neutral *
2/15 - Boston, MA - Middle East *
* = w/ The Depreciation Guild
# = w/ Cause Co-Motion!
